Exact controllability of the vortex system by means of a single vortex
Abstract
In this paper, we investigate the controllability of the point vortex system by means of a single vortex. The point vortex system is a well-known simplied model for the incompressible Euler equation, where the vorticity is concentrated in a nite number of Dirac masses. We use one of the vortices as a control, and prove that by suitably choosing its trajectory, we can drive all other vortices to a given prescribed position in arbitrary time.
